MY REVIEW:

My first listen to “Adore” was in the car with my husband and may I say I was underwhelmed? The volume was down low and I could not concentrate on the music because of conversation and road noise. At that point I would have given it a ho hum review. The next time I needed to make a trip in the car I decided to give it another chance. I was alone and could crank up the volume without annoying my husband. I also do my best listening in the car since I usually have at least a thirty minute drive with very few distractions other than traffic.

Second time was a charm. At the greater volume the songs literally came alive. Without distractions I was also able to actually understand the lyrics. As usual, Chris Tomlin came through with his own interpretation to several well-known Christmas songs – sometimes by the addition of lyrics and other times by creating a unique medley of several songs. Other unfamiliar songs were also excellent and the combination of songs is one that relates the true meaning of Christmas and should help bring listeners to worship. I can imagine that many worship services may include some of these songs during this Christmas season. One particular line that has stuck with me is “Jesus, the love song of God”. How meaningful is that?

With a wonderful list of songs and such a great group of guest artists, “Adore” is certain to be a favorite for years to come.

 Chris Tomlin  Chris Tomlin is an American contemporary Christian music artist, worship leader, and songwriter who has sold nearly 30 million records.  Some of his most well-known songs are “How Great Is Our God”, “Jesus Messiah”, “Amazing Grace (My Chains Are Gone)”, “Our God”, and “Whom Shall I Fear”.  His 2013 album Burning Lights debuted at No. 1 on the Billboard 200, only the fourth Christian album ever to open at No.1.  Throughout his career, Chris has been nominated for 32 Dove Awards (6 of them collaborative efforts) and he has won 19 of them.

MY REVIEW:

Book two in Thompson’s Brides With Style series continues Katie Fisher’s tale. Still happy working in the Dallas bridal salon and pretty sure she is in love with Brady James, Katie is blind-sided by a few things that make her question her choices. What is a gal to do when the man she thought she would marry turns up in her life again and all signs point to his wanting to renew their relationship – especially when the man she loves has suddenly gone into a depression and seems to be avoiding her?

In her unique style, Janice Thompson has once again offered her readers a humorous yet thoughtful novel that is brimming over with romance. Her characters are fresh and lovable and the plot just grabs you and pulls you along for the ride. I loved reading about the preparations and showers for Katie’s grandmother’s wedding. My, there were some laugh-out-loud scenes there, especially the one involving the wedding punch. You just have to read it!

But seriously, almost hiding behind all the fun and romance is a strong lesson about not trying to micromanage our lives but to just relax and let God have control. One more reminder of why I love Janice’s books.

If you have never read a Janice Thompson novel, please take my advice and pick up both books in this series. If you have any sense of humor at all, I think you will love them.

ABOUT THE AUTHOR:

Janice ThompsonJanice Thompson is a seasoned romance author and screenwriter. An expert at pulling the humor from the situations we get ourselves into, Thompson offers an inside look at the wedding business, drawing on her own experiences as a wedding planner. She is the author of the hugely popular Weddings by Bella series and the Backstage Pass series, as well as Picture Perfect, The Icing on the Cake, and The Dream Dress. She lives in Texas. MY REVIEW:

My past experiences with Katy Lee’s novels have proven that I can count on her for an exciting and suspense-filled evening. I also know that I don’t have to worry about running across any explicit intimacy or gruesome violence. For the icing on the cake, I know that I will also find a strong vein of truth and faith running throughout the pages. As the first book in her new Roads to Danger series, “Silent Night Pursuit” totally lived up to my expectations.

Lacey Phillips takes a road trip to learn what Wade Spencer might know about why her brother died. Fully expecting to be back home in time for Christmas dinner, Lacey quickly finds herself in the middle of much more than she expected and begins to wonder if she will ever make it back home at all. Against his will, Wade is forced to flee with Lacey as they both run for their very lives.

Katy Lee seems to get better with each book. In “Silent Night Pursuit” she has amped up the danger and suspense with some absolutely breath-stopping scenes and a mystery that might just surprise most readers. Of course the reader will also expect a romance to develop because that is the very nature of any Love Inspired novel but I particularly liked the way this one developed.

I am really afraid to say more for fear of spoilers but I will say that “Silent Night Pursuit” is the perfect mystery/suspense to have on hand if one finds a few spare moments during the hustle and bustle of holiday preparations. And – it would even be a good read after the holidays. I loved it!

ABOUT “AFTER THE RAIN”:

It’s 1908, a year in the Edwardian Age, the year J.M. Barrie’s play ‘What Every Woman Knows’, premiered in Atlantic City and the first Model T rolled off the assembly line in Detroit. It is a year when the world faced one of its worst disasters in history, when the New Year would heal the wounds of loss.

Louisa Borden lives a privileged life in Chevy Chase, Maryland, a new and thriving community on the outskirts of Washington, DC for the well-to-do. Against the wishes of her domineering grandmother, she retreats from the prospects of a loveless marriage and instead searches for what she hopes is her calling in life.

When her horse is spooked along Rock Creek, she is thrown from the saddle—an embarrassing situation for any affluent young lady. Soaking wet, bruised and humiliated, she is carried up the muddy bank to safety by Jackson O’Neil, a stranger to the city, who changes the course of everything, including the lives of all those around her.
